SHOP NOTES: "Your wheels need to be coplanar" "Your tires are crowned" "The top wheel tilts forward and backward" "The blade rides in the center of the wheels". All myths. At least when we are talking about the Shopsmith Bandsaw.
In the video, we'll continue our chat about the Shopsmith bandsaw and give you a couple tips on how they work and what you might need to do to keep yours tracking properly.
